About the Role
The Senior M&A Program Manager (L6) is a high-impact, leadership role that serves as a principal architect of the M&A People strategy and operational methodology . You will move beyond managing individual transactions to leading a portfolio of complex, high-stakes integrations and owning the scalability of the entire People M&A function. This role requires deep People domain expertise, a strategic planning mindset, and the proven ability to influence senior leaders and navigate significant global ambiguity. You have to be comfortable pushing back on the business and other key stakeholders. You will be accountable for defining success metrics, managing execution risk across multiple jurisdictions, and ensuring the M&A process delivers a world-class employee experience.

For New York, NY-based roles: The base salary range for this role is USD$175,000 per year - USD$194,000 per year.
For San Francisco, CA-based roles: The base salary range for this role is USD$175,000 per year - USD$194,000 per year.
For all US locations, you will be eligible to participate in Uber's bonus program, and may be offered an equity award & other types of comp. All full-time employees are eligible to participate in a 401(k) plan. You will also be eligible for various benefits. More details can be found at the following link .
